How Carpet Cleaning Works
The process should feel straightforward for the customer. Once the booking is arranged, the cleaning team will arrive with the right tools and set up the work area carefully. Furniture may be moved where practical, and protective steps are taken to reduce disruption around the property. In many Chelsea homes, that means working with limited space, protecting flooring in hallways, and being careful around valuable furniture and décor.
After preparation, the carpet is usually vacuumed and treated with a suitable pre-spray or spot solution. This loosens dirt and helps break down stubborn areas before the main clean begins. The technician then uses the chosen cleaning method to lift soil from the fibres. In a deep-clean process, moisture and cleaning solution are extracted together, helping remove contamination rather than simply spreading it around.
Once the cleaning stage is complete, any remaining spots may receive further attention if appropriate. The carpet can then be groomed or set to encourage an even finish and improve drying. The drying time varies depending on carpet type, ventilation, weather, and the cleaning method used. Good airflow, opened windows where practical, and sensible room use afterward all help the carpet dry efficiently.
Why the method matters
There is no single solution for every carpet. A thick wool carpet in a Chelsea townhouse may need a careful, controlled treatment, while a synthetic carpet in a busy office may benefit from a different approach. Using the right method helps maintain appearance and extend the life of the fibres. A well-cleaned carpet should not only look better but also feel softer, smell fresher, and contribute to a more pleasant indoor space.
Before and after expectations
Customers often want to know what to expect realistically. In many cases, carpets look noticeably brighter, feel less gritty, and smell cleaner after a professional service. Heavily worn traffic areas may improve substantially, though deep wear or permanent fibre damage will not disappear completely. A reputable local service will explain these differences clearly so you can make an informed choice.

Pricing Factors and What Affects the Quote
Customers often want to know what influences carpet cleaning cost, even if exact pricing is only available after a proper assessment. Several practical factors can affect the quote, including the size of the area, the type of carpet, the level of soiling, the number of rooms or stairs, and whether spot treatment or deodorising is required. Commercial projects may also depend on timing, access requirements, and the scope of the premises.
It is also worth noting that heavily soiled carpets, delicate fibres, or difficult access can influence the time needed to complete the work. For example, a top-floor flat with limited parking and narrow stairs may require more planning than a straightforward ground-floor room. Likewise, a carpet with multiple stains or pet odours may need extra pre-treatment and attention.

How often should carpets be professionally cleaned?
That depends on how much traffic the area receives. Busy family homes, pet households, and commercial premises may need cleaning more often than quieter rooms or rarely used spaces. Many customers arrange cleaning when carpets begin to look dull, when odours build up, or after spills and seasonal deep cleans.
Will the carpet be very wet afterwards?
Drying time depends on the method used, the carpet material, and ventilation in the property. A good cleaning approach aims to remove as much moisture as practical so the carpet can dry within a reasonable timeframe. Opening windows where possible and improving airflow can help.
Can you help with old stains?
In many cases, yes, though results vary. Some stains respond well to targeted pre-treatment, while others may have permanently altered the fibre or dye. The sooner a stain is treated, the better the chance of improvement. Avoid scrubbing hard or using random household chemicals, as this can spread the mark or damage the carpet.
